Today Jason and I, along with our friends Christie and Nathaniel, went on a field trip to Alamance Battlefield in Burlington, NC. Every October they have something called "Colonial Week", where interpreters demonstrate a variety of things from the lives of backcountry farmers during the Colonial period. Alamance is the site of a battle between the Regulators and the Governor's militia, about 10 years prior to the start of the American Revolution. The Regulators were farmers who were fed up with the excessive taxes and corruption of those ruling the British colony.
